Code Enforcement officers partner with other City departments to effectively enforce housing, building, fire and life safety codes to maintain life safety standards in Shelton.
Common code enforcement issues we see include:
- Dangerous structures
- Accumulation of litter or debris
- Used, damaged, or discarded lumber, furniture, junk, or trash visible from public view
- Detrimental maintenance of property (including tall grass)
- Inoperable and/or junk vehicles parked on front, side, and rear yards
- Maintenance of property as to cause a public nuisance
- Excessive junk or debris accumulation in public view
Report a code enforcement violation
To report a City of Shelton code violation, you can file a report online or through the City's mobile app.
Please note that inaccurate or incomplete information will delay or prevent further processing of a code enforcement report. Please provide as much information as possible when reporting a potential violation. If additional information is required, a Code Enforcement officer will contact you.
